Chinese expansion meets a civil conflict in Ethiopia

Ethiopia has profited from Chinese investment, which is credited with restarting the African nation’s economy. But an internal struggle between Ethiopia’s central government and the opposition party that runs the northern region, Tigray, poses new challenges. Journalists Mary Kay Magistad and Tesfalem Waldyes reported from Ethiopia, and now update the story with host Marco Werman.
